WebMay 22, 2024 · Spotting is when you see a light or trace amount of pink, red, or dark brown (rust-colored) blood. You may notice spotting when you use the restroom or see a few drops of blood on your... WebMay 19, 2024 · 2. Check for a light pink or brown color. Menstrual bleeding may start out brown or light pink, but it typically progresses to a bright or dark red flow within a day or so. Implantation bleeding typically stays brown or pink, however. WebNov 18, 2024 · If you spot bleed on a regular basis, you should schedule an appointment to see your doctor. Your doctor will go over your symptoms and do a physical exam to assess you and likely will do other tests, such as a pelvic exam, a Pap smear, a pregnancy test or a vaginal or abdominal ultrasound to diagnose what is causing the irregular bleeding ... WebSt. John‘s Church in Svaty Jan pod Skalou was built at the beginning of the 13th century near the legendary and fabulous St. Ivan‘s Cave. A provostship since 1310, then an abbotship since 1517. Today‘s view of the ground with St.John the Baptist‘s Nativity Church dates back to its renovation in the 17th and 18th centuries.
